Publique o aplicativo Asp.Net Core simples (.Net Framework) com o WebJob
Gostaria de criar um aplicativo Web ASP.NET Core simples (.NET Framework) e publicar um WebJob ao lado dele no Azure.
Estou usando o Visual Studio 2017, mas o resultado parece ser o mesmo no VS2015.
Para começar, eu crio o projeto correspondente no VS2017:
Eu seleciono o modelo básico de aplicativo da web:
Neste ponto, eu me perco um pouco. Na abordagem mais antiga do Asp.Net MVC 5, eu costumava clicar no projeto Asp.Net e encontrar "Adicionar => Novo Projeto de Webjobs do Azure". O WebJob sempre seria vinculado na publicação e apenas "funcionaria".
Com a nova abordagem do Asp.Net Core, não consigo encontrar uma maneira analogamente fácil de fazer isso acontecer.
Tentei adicionar manualmente um projeto WebJobs à solução e configurar manualmente o arquivo webjobs-list.json no projeto Asp.Net, mas a etapa de publicação não o reconheceu. Notei várias respostas comoeste que sugerem a participação no processo de publicação para copiar os arquivos, mas a marcação adicionada ao arquivo * .pubxml não afetou (ou seja, os arquivos não estavam sendo copiados).
Parece que há um pouco de informações desatualizadas em relação a essa tarefa. Alguém pode detalhar o processo atual de fazer isso para uma nova solução que contém um aplicativo Asp.Net Core no Visual Studio?